How do I choose the right size for a women's bracelet?
To find your perfect fit, measure your wrist with a flexible tape measure and add 1-2 cm for comfort. This ensures your chosen piece of ladies' wristwear has the right amount of movement. Getting the sizing right is key to enjoying the everyday elegance of Minkcolour Women's Bracelets.
How can I best care for my gold or platinum Minkcolour bracelet?
To maintain its lustre, gently clean your bracelet with a soft, lint-free cloth and a mild soap solution. Avoid exposing it to harsh chemicals and store it separately to prevent scratches. Finding the Right Bracelet for Your Lifestyle and Skin Tone

Minkcolour gold’s unique composition makes it flattering for a diverse range of skin tones. Its blend of warm and neutral undertones provides a soft glow against fair skin with cool undertones, without appearing too stark. It also beautifully enhances the natural warmth in olive, medium, and deeper complexions, offering a sophisticated alternative to the brighter tones of yellow or rose gold. In terms of lifestyle, the choice of gold purity is a key consideration. If you plan to wear your bracelet daily, a 9ct or 14ct option provides increased durability and resistance to everyday wear and tear. For a piece reserved for more meaningful occasions, 18ct gold offers a deeper, richer colour and a more substantial feel. This bracelet is well suited for individuals with a classic, minimalist, or contemporary style who value accessories that are both distinctive and enduring. 9ct gold is composed of 37.5% pure gold, making it the most durable and resistant to scratches among the common gold alloys.
